Preview, Game Day #10: Anaheim Ducks @ Los Angeles Kings

Game Day #10: Anaheim Ducks (3-4-2) @ Los Angeles Kings (4-5-0)

How to Watch and Line Combinations

What Kings fans will be watching for: Cliche, but true: Your best players have to get your team going when you’re in a slump. Anze Kopitar had points in six of seven games before LA’s two shutout losses, and a matchup with Anaheim should get him back on the scoresheet. Last year, he had points in all five games against the Ducks, and in his career he has 59 points in 55 games against LA’s crosstown rivals.

What Ducks fans will be watching for: Rickard Rakell was fourth in scoring on the Anaheim Ducks last season, and he was sorely missed in the season’s first month. After signing on October 14, Rakell has finally worked himself into game shape, and it appears he’ll slot in on the third line tonight. They’re probably excited.

What everyone else will be watching for: The Ducks were shut out 4-0 on Friday. The Kings have been shut out twice in a row. Can anyone actually score? Also, this is an actual rivalry, and now that Oilers-Leafs is done you might as well tune in.

Key Players: Devin Setoguchi and Rickard Rakell. Setoguchi has failed to find the net for the Kings, and it feels like his time to make an impression in LA is waning. Meanwhile, Rakell is making his season debut, and he’s going to make an impression sooner or later. Hopefully it isn’t tonight.
